Verdict Reached: 83-Year-Old Man Found Guilty of Murdering Uber Driver in Clark County

Jurors in Clark County reached a verdict in the case of an 83-year-old man accused of shooting and killing an Uber driver. William Brock was found guilty on multiple charges, including murder, assault, and kidnapping. The defense claimed self-defense, but the jury disagreed, stating that the victim, Lo-Letha Hall, was an innocent victim. The incident occurred in March 2024, when scammers targeted both Brock and Hall. Brock testified that he felt threatened when Hall arrived at his home, leading to a fatal confrontation. The prosecutor expressed the tragedy of the situation and the hope for justice for both families involved. Brock will face sentencing in January.
